Transaction 16568351ebdf814e764c2dc87ad6bdf419cb62ee3a66195ccf2a903c7d9976f4
1 Input
1 Output
-
16568351ebdf814e764c2dc87ad6bdf419cb62ee3a66195ccf2a903c7d9976f4:0
- value
- 4541895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e226b477c72efb3ff1e7ba393396372e4414c53e OP_EQUAL
- address
- 3NJo1AWFt9q7a2DTcb1RYsoXp6cx7bptEU